Product Features

  • Charges & docks 2 Wii remotes & charges 2 extra additional battery packs in rear compartment
  • Matches Wii console
  • Base glows as batteries charge
  • Plugs into USB port
  • Includes 4 battery packs

5.0 out of 5 stars Great Product, but BEWARE MISCONCEPTION, October 9, 2009

It's great that this comes with four battery packs. Less down time in between plays is a plus. This accessory lacks some of the features of slightly more expensive docks, like charging when you set the wiimote in its cradle. Still, this product is exactly what you need if you normally play with one or two controllers at a time. There are only two charging slots, so if you're planning 4-player action, you would have to charge ahead of time. The Wii I bought it for wasn't going to be used for more than two people, so this is perfect. Another plus is the blue led glow that matches your Wii disk slot, but can be turned off.

Also, note that none of the chargers I have seen, including this one, are compatible with the standard or motion plus jelly sleeves, which happen to be the best Wii accessory I have used so far. It's not as carefree as the pictures would have you think. Even induction chargers (the type that charge through contact plates whan you set them down) can't charge with an insulating cover on the back. If you use the rubber jackets, then no matter which dock you buy, you will always have to take the jacket off to charge the battery pack - which is every time you play.

So, great value, but don't be disappointed if you use rubber jackets.

I am very glad I purchased this. It comes with the 4 extra batteries, which often comes in handy. My only gripe is that it only charges 2 at a time. The dock (where you put the remotes) doesn't actually charge or connect to that spot. They just sit in there.
